Mark Wizel
Mark Wizel holds over 15 years of experience in the Australian property industry, previously heading CBRE as the National Sales Director where he was involved in large-scale asset disposal projects and proved his strengths in marketing, process building, sales and leasing.
Mark’s sales prowess can be traced back to the age of 13 where he would assist his father in selling Australian sheepskin products in the draughty stalls of Melbourne’s Queen Victoria market. Exposed to a diverse range of shoppers from a young age, he was able to build up his sales toolkit to withstand all sorts of customers – ultimately this helped shape his skillset today.
Fast forward several years and Mark launched a formidable commercial property career off the back of the Global Financial Crisis, seeking mentorship from property greats and finding opportunities in a market of high uncertainty under the green umbrella of CBRE. In the seven years between 2012 to 2019, he assembled and trained an agency team that would go on to dominate the commercial property market across nearly every asset class. At its peak, the team exceeded revenue growth ten-fold from $2.4mil to $29.6m in 2017 across 200 transactions with a clearance rate of 90% – the green machine at CBRE transacted over $20bn in sales over the seven-year period.

Lewis Tong
Lewis was born in Hong Kong and immigrated with his family to Australia in the mid-80s. During the 90s his family established an import/export trading business in Australia and a small retail business where he first got his exposure to property.
In 2006, Lewis joined CBRE as a commercial property valuer in industrial, office, retail, and development sites and in 2009 moved into Commercial property transactions where he specialised in transacting commercial property with Asian Capital. He was made National Director of the Australian Asian Desk in 2018 across Australia and managed a team of 30 people.
2018 – Lewis is recognised by the Real Estate Institute of Victoria (REIV) as the Commercial Agent of the Year.

Tony Rafaniello
Over 25 year’s experience in the design, development and operation of large-scale, high-volume property infrastructure.
Founding senior executive of Crown Melbourne. During 16 years with Crown held various operational and project positions including Project Director–Design & Development, and Chief Operating Officer.
Design Director for City of Dreams Macau–A US$2billion integrated casino-hotel-entertainment complex.
General Manager of Chadstone as it undertook a $580million transition into an integrated retail-leisure commercial complex, with revenues exceeding $2billion.
Development of design briefs to ensure the infrastructure is designed to leverage the underlying business strategy; objectives are clear; design time and cost are minimised; assets can be efficiently operated and maintained.
Project management of design consultant teams including architects, service engineers, structural engineers, urban planners, and transport consultants. Extensive operational experience at senior executive level across a diverse range of operational departments.
Global perspective having worked in the United States, Hong Kong, Macau and Canada.
